Distinguish different TYPES of media on Specimen Results table (via differing icons) #485

Open GoogleCodeExporter opened 9 years ago

GoogleCodeExporter commented 9 years ago
Now that we have more than one type of media and links associated with 
specimens (eg. fieldnotes, images, publication, project, external links to 
GenBank) it would be more useful to have icons representing the types to show 
up in the specimen results table instead of a generic 'media' that shows up 
now. Thus users can see immediately which specimens have images, fieldnotes, or 
GenBank links associated with it.

This was suggested by multiple people once they started seeing specimen detail 
pages with multiple media associated with it.

I agree. It would be very useful in Specimen Results list to distinguish images 
from audio from multi-page documents etc. One option would be to replace 
"media" with the media type in the specimen results list. Another cooler option 
- but more space intensive? - would be to include different icons. For example, 
for audio I'd like to see an embedded player that plays the audio recording. 
(Dusty, we are getting very close to having a fully functional html5 code for 
playing and downloading audio in different browsers, should be able to show you 
soon for testing and next step of integration with Arctos).

This is possibly something that Mike (MVZ undergrad programmer) can help with?

GenBank isn't Media, but rather an Other ID. While some folks might find that 
(or Media) interesting, I suspect most don't care about at least one of those 
things. I added the Media notification mostly as a way to let people know that 
Arctos contains more than ASCII characters describing dead rats. I think that 
may be accomplished, and I now question the utility of the notification at all. 

At the very least, I don't want to turn what was supposed to be an unobtrusive 
"you might find this record interesting" notification into an "EVERYTHING is 
interesting!! OMFG!! Field notes!!!!! Let me blast a chickadee call through 
your speakers without your permission!!!" thing. 

There are at least two ways to see Media in SpecimenResults - the default small 
green notification thing, and by customizing the form. Which are we talking 
about here?
